Cleaning power and suction

Traditionally, corded vacuums have had the edge when it comes to raw cleaning power.

Using mains electricity allows them to utilize more powerful motors, resulting in stronger suction.

This makes them particularly effective for deep-cleaning carpets and tackling stubborn dirt and debris.

Versatility

Both corded and cordless vacuums can come with a variety of attachments for different cleaning tasks.

However, cordless models, especially stick vacuums, often have an edge in terms of versatility.

Cost

Cordless vacuums tend to be more expensive than comparable corded models due to the cost of battery technology.

That said, there are more budget-friendly cordless options available.
